Output 65fefa53222d848e4e364c0e5f79e85897ac5aed679af2132aa760862ff64522:0

value
34967854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4753e75abc757a43cd5361c64a880ecb94d0e00f OP_EQUAL
address
38CAQtyca37x3j8XVWVmSHC6DkcA7TnLQp
transaction
65fefa53222d848e4e364c0e5f79e85897ac5aed679af2132aa760862ff64522
spent
true